The 2011 Women's Leadership Conference (WLC) welcomes women of all ages from Tech and the Atlanta-area community. The WLC, sponsored by the Georgia Tech Women's Resource Center, will feature 15 empowering workshops, five leadership awards, three inspiring keynote speakers, three catered meals and a networking reception.
Keynote speakers include:
- Friday evening: Annie Eaton, director of CSC Policy Compliance Initiative and professor in the Department of Computer Science, College of Engineering, North Carolina State University
- Saturday breakfast: Gail Evans, author of "Play Like a Man, Win Like a Woman" and "She Wins, You Win"
- Saturday lunch: Laura Finney, CEO of We Can Do That and Laura Finney Enterprises
Registration opens on Sept. 23.
- Early registration fee (until Oct. 14): $10 for students/ $25 for nonstudents
- Regular registration fee (until Oct. 21): $15 for students/ $30 for nonstudents
